Parkinson’s Disease With and Without History of Agent Orange Exposure: A Prospective Study of US Veterans

2026-01-24

Abstract excerpt

Environmental neurotoxins have been implicated in the pathogenesis of Parkinsons disease (PD), with Agent Orange (AO) recognized as a presumptive service-connected exposure among U.S. Veterans. However, prospective data examining potential clinical differences associated with AO exposure remain limited. We conducted a multicenter prospective cohort study of U.S. Veterans with PD to compare demographic and clinical...
